CalDAV로 일정 관리하기 (1) : 준비 [윈도우/안드로이드]

 

무료로 사용 가능한 오픈소스 앱들로 이메일과 일정, 주소록을 쉽게 관리할 수 없을까.

모바일과 PC에서 동기화도 가능한 시스템은 없을까.

구글 캘린더와 아웃룩은 쓰다 보면 어딘가 아쉽고, 무겁고, 내 용도에는 맞지 않았다.
그렇다고 유료 앱들로 넘어가자니 딱히 마음에 드는 게 없었다.
쓸모없는 AI 기능으로 무거워지기만 하고 가볍고 실용적인 앱들은 별로 없었다.

 

 

내가 찾고자 하는 앱들은 이러했다.

 

  • 협업 기능 X, 오직 실용적이고 개인적인 용도로만 기능할 것
  • 최대한 FOSS(Free and open-source software)= 무료이고 오픈소스일 것.
  • 서버 구축(셀프 호스팅, NAS)에 대한 지식이 없어도 된다
  • 인터페이스가 못생겨도 괜찮다

 

서칭 결과,

  1. mailbox.org (CalDAV 서버를 대신해 줄 이메일 서비스)
  2. DAVx⁵ (CalDAV를 위한 동기화 앱)
  3. Tasks.org (할 일 관리 앱)
  4. Fossify Calendar (캘린더 앱)
  5. Thunderbird (PC로 사용할 캘린더, 할 일 관리 앱)

5개의 앱을 찾았고 이것을 CalDAV로 연동했다.

개략적으로 살펴보면 이렇다

  1. mailbox.org 계정으로 CalDAV 서버를 대신한다.
  2. CalDAV 동기화는 DAVx⁵라는 앱에 맡긴다.
  3. 마음에 드는 오픈소스 앱들을 자유롭게 이용한다.

(CalDAV는 '일정 관리를 위해 널리 사용되는 표준 프로토콜'이다. 몰라도 되고 나도 이번 기회에 처음 알게 됐다)

 

이번 글에서는 mailbox.org와 DAVx⁵를 알아볼 것이다.

mailbox.org

 

독일 기반 이메일 서비스 회사다.
카드정보를 기입할 필요도 없이 첫 30일 완전 무료다.
다른 곳도 살펴봤는데 여기가 제일 싸고 체험 기간도 제일 길다.

 

라이트 플랜은 한달 1유로.
(다만 연간 결제만 지원해서 12유로를 일회성으로 지불해야 한다)
기본적인 이메일, 캘린더, 할 일, 주소록을 모두 지원하기 때문에 굉장히 합리적인 가격이라고 생각한다.
상위 플랜으로 업글하면 여러 클라우드 기능도 사용할 수 있다.

 

플랜을 아무거나 클릭하면 이메일과 비밀번호, 비밀번호 확인 란이 나타난다.

 

대충 가입하고 로그인한다.

 

웹 인터페이스는 이러한데, 뭔가 반응이 느리고 Y2K 냄새가 난다.

 

다음 단계는 이렇다

  • 안드로이드 폰은 F-Droid에 올라온 오픈 소스앱들로 채울 것이다.
  • 윈도우 PC에서는 썬더버드로 모든 걸 올인원으로 관리할 것이다.

모바일

내가 소개한 앱들은 모두 구글 플레이 스토어에 출시되어 있다.

다만 DAVx⁵는 유료고, Tasks.org도 프로 구독을 해야만 동기화를 허용한다.

기왕 예산을 줄인김에 앱들을 대안적인 안드로이드 플랫폼인 F-Droid에서 다운로드하기로 했다.

이 플랫폼에서는 모두 무료로 다운받을 수 있다.

 

https://f-droid.org/

 

F-Droid - Free and Open Source Android App Repository

F-Droid는 Android 플랫폼을 위한 설치 가능한 FOSS (자유-오픈 소스 소프트웨어) 애플리케이션의 카탈로그입니다. 클라이언트는 여러분의 기기에서 찾아보고, 설치하고, 업데이트의 추적을 유지하는

f-droid.org

 

F-Droid 오피셜 홈페이지에서 F-Droid의 apk 파일을 다운로드하고 설치한다.
진짜 설치할 거냐고 무섭게 경고하는데 걍 씹고 설치한다.

갤럭시의 경우 보안 폴더 안에서 진행해도 된다.

 

DAVx⁵

제일 처음 받아야 할 앱은 DAVx⁵라는 앱이다.

안드로이드 디바이스는 어쩐지 기본적으로 CalDAV를 받아오는 기능이 없다.

그래서 이 앱이 필요하다.

이 앱만 다운받으면 기본 캘린더를 이용할 수 있어서 사실상 튜토리얼 종결이다.

 

이걸 F-Droid 앱 내에서 다운로드한다.

플레이스토어에서는 유료로 판매 중인데 여기선 무료다.

 

 

 

다운로드하고 나서는 배터리 권한이나 캘린더 접근 권한을 모두 허용한다.

그리고 앱 메인 화면에서 추가(+) 버튼을 누른다.

 


가입한 mailbox.org 이메일과 해당 계정의 비밀번호를 입력.

추가로 권한을 요구하면 다 허용으로 바꿔준다.

끝.

 

이제 폰에 CalDAV가 연결된 상태다.

기본 캘린더를 실행하고 설정-캘린더 관리로 들어가면 이런 식으로 나온다.

 

 

 

다음 글에서는 일정 관리에 유용한 오픈소스 앱들을 이어서 살펴보겠다.

 

https://higherthanthemoon.tistory.com/14

 

CalDAV로 일정 관리하기 (2) : 유용한 무료 앱들 소개 [윈도우/안드로이드]

Tasks.org (할 일 관리 앱) Tasks는 구글 플레이 스토어와 F-Droid에 모두 출시되어 있다. 다만 구글에선 유료인 동기화 옵션이 F-Droid 플랫폼에선 무료라서 이쪽에서 받는 걸 추천한다. https://f-droid.org/pa

higherthanthemoon.tistory.com